EastEnders star Jessie Wallace has revealed she ‘burst out crying’ after reuniting with her on screen daughter Michelle Ryan amid her return to the soap.
During her time on the show, Michelle, now 41, was involved in one of the soap’s biggest storylines when it was revealed that Kat Slater (Jessie) was in fact Zoe’s mother and not her sister, with explosive scenes seeing her yell: ‘You ain’t my mother!’, only for Kat to reply: ‘Yes I am!’
And now, after returning to Albert Square two decades after her dramatic exit, Jessie revealed she was overcome with emotion at the news.
Speaking in an interview with the Radio Times she confessed that they reunited at a secret dinner date with the executive producers.
‘I burst out crying….When I saw Michelle, I cried – we were all very emotional. It was nostalgic and lovely.’
While it isn’t uncommon for roles to be recast in the soap world, Jessie was also determined that if Zoe returned it could only be Michelle.

‘I said to Ben [executive producer], “It has to be Michelle. It won’t feel right if Zoe is recast.” I wouldn’t be able to give my best performance. The audience would feel completely conned.’
She added: ‘I love Michelle and have always been protective over her, perhaps that’s natural having played her mum. I’m a mother myself now, which I wasn’t when we worked together before, and I’m very protective over my daughter.’
Michelle had been asked to return to the soap before but had always declined.
However this time she felt the time was right after she was moved after seeing the comments on social media following EastEnders’ 40th anniversary.
After reminiscing on her time on the soap with colleagues she mentioned to her agent that she would go back and as coincidence would have it EastEnders had already been on the phone.
Back in June Zoe made a bombshell return to the BBC soap, after her return was kept under wraps.
Viewers then saw Zoe in two further episodes that week but she will now be back full-time this summer, as her mother Kat prepares to tie the knot with Alfie Moon for the third time.
Speaking previously on her return to the BBC soap, Michelle said: ‘It feels like coming home. After doing my first few scenes, it was like I’d never been away. It all happened at the right time.

‘I’d already been thinking about a return because I’d met up with Kacey Ainsworth (Little Mo) and Kim Medcalf (Sam Mitchell) and we were reminiscing our fond memories of the show, and I’d also joined social media and saw that there was still a lot of love for the character.
‘It just so happened that at the same time, EastEnders had announced a new Exec who was keen to explore the potential of a return as he was such a massive fan of Zoe and the Slaters, so both of our worlds aligned at the right time, and I’m so excited to be back.
‘When I was pitched the storylines, and when I read the scripts, I knew it was the right decision.’
EastEnders new boss, Executive Producer Ben Wadey added: ‘Before I even stepped into the role, Zoe Slater was on my wish-list of returnees as, although we haven’t seen her on screen for twenty years, her character has transcended time due to her popular storylines.’
Since Zoe’s exit from Walford 20 years ago, it’s been revealed that she and Kat have become estranged.
Teasing her character’s reason to come back to Albert Square, Michelle added: ‘I can’t say too much as there is a lot of drama to come, but Zoe is a mess.
‘She’s not the girl that left Walford twenty years ago, and she’s been really struggling on her own.
‘She has her defences up, but this week you will see that she needs help, but whether she is willing to accept it is another story.’

It comes after Daily Mail revealed in February that, despite multiple attempts from bosses over the years, Michelle had refused to return to EastEnders.
A source revealed: ‘Bosses reached out to Michelle several times over the years, they would love to have her back. For example, as the soap was approaching its big 30th anniversary, it was a gentle approach asking if she would consider a return in the lead up to it all.
‘This was at the very early stages of their plans but Michelle refused and there was a lot of disappointment amongst bosses.
‘It’s always been quite baffling why she wouldn’t want to reprise a character who is still very much adored by the fans. It’s been 20 years since she left Albert Square but still people are talking about her character.’
